The Importance of Professional SEO Consultancy

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is a critical component of any successful digital marketing strategy. In today’s competitive online landscape, having a strong SEO presence can make all the difference in driving traffic to your website and increasing visibility.

Professional SEO consultancy services offer invaluable expertise and guidance to help businesses navigate the complex world of search engine algorithms and ranking factors. Here are some key reasons why investing in professional SEO consultancy is essential:

  1. Strategic Planning: SEO consultants can develop tailored strategies to improve your website’s search engine rankings based on thorough analysis and industry best practices.
  2. Technical Expertise: Professionals have in-depth knowledge of technical SEO aspects such as site structure, mobile-friendliness, and page speed optimization, ensuring your website meets search engine requirements.
  3. Keyword Research: Consultants conduct comprehensive keyword research to identify relevant terms that will drive targeted traffic to your site, increasing the likelihood of conversion.
  4. Content Optimization: SEO experts can optimise your website content for search engines while maintaining readability and relevance for human visitors, striking a crucial balance for success.
  5. Monitoring and Reporting: Consultants continuously monitor your site’s performance, track key metrics, and provide detailed reports on progress and areas for improvement.

In conclusion, professional SEO consultancy plays a vital role in enhancing your online presence, attracting quality traffic, and ultimately boosting business growth. By partnering with experienced consultants, you can stay ahead of the competition and achieve sustainable results in the ever-evolving digital landscape.

2. Optimise on-page elements such as meta tags, headings, and content to improve search engine visibility.

To enhance search engine visibility and improve website rankings, it is crucial to optimise on-page elements effectively. This includes refining meta tags, headings, and content to align with relevant keywords and user intent. By strategically incorporating targeted keywords into these on-page elements, businesses can signal to search engines the relevance of their content, thereby increasing the likelihood of being prominently displayed in search results. A comprehensive approach to on-page optimisation not only boosts SEO performance but also enhances user experience by providing valuable and easily accessible information to visitors.

How much do consultants typically charge for their services?

When it comes to the fees charged by consultants for their services, the rates can vary significantly depending on several factors. Consultants often tailor their pricing based on the scope of the project, the level of expertise required, the duration of the engagement, and the specific industry in which they operate. Some consultants may charge an hourly rate, while others prefer a project-based fee structure. Additionally, consultants with specialised skills or extensive experience may command higher rates than those who are just starting out in their careers. Ultimately, the cost of hiring a consultant is an investment in expertise and results that can bring significant value to a business in the long run.

How long does a consulting engagement usually last?

The duration of a consulting engagement can vary significantly depending on the scope and complexity of the project. In general, consulting engagements can last anywhere from a few weeks to several months, or even extend to a year or more for larger, more intricate initiatives. Factors such as the objectives of the project, the level of collaboration required, and the resources available can all influence the duration of the engagement. Consultants typically work closely with their clients to establish clear timelines and milestones to ensure that the project stays on track and delivers meaningful results within an agreed-upon timeframe.

What is the process of working with a consultant like?

The process of working with a consultant typically begins with an initial consultation to discuss the client’s needs, objectives, and expectations. This phase is crucial for the consultant to gain a thorough understanding of the client’s business, challenges, and goals. Following this, the consultant will develop a tailored proposal outlining the scope of work, timeline, deliverables, and cost estimates. Once the proposal is approved, the consultant will collaborate closely with the client to execute the agreed-upon plan, providing regular updates, feedback, and recommendations along the way. Effective communication, transparency, and mutual trust are key elements in ensuring a successful partnership between a client and a consultant.
